I'm reveiwing the new television show, Huge.

Huge is a new show on ABCFamily that's about kids at fat camp. Yes. Fat camp. These are normal teenagers dealing with problems concerning their weight, inner demons, sexuality, trust, what have you. It's different from the other ABCFamily shows in that it's not over the top or far fetched like Secret Life or Make It or Break It. It's real. And it sure as hell hits close to home when I watch it.

I guess that's why I like the show so much. It's relatable. So many teens today go through self image issues and this show really touches on it.

The acting is admittedly eh... It's not great, but it's better than living through an episode of Secret Life. And Nikki Blonsky's just hilarious. Her sarcasm is great. It kind of reminds me of mine.

Well, I give Huge three angsty, over weight teens out of five.

Teavana: A Review of my Favorite Tea Haven

Ah... tea. There's no beverage more relaxing. No beverage more elegant. No beverage more social than tea. I love tea. It's my favorite thing to drink. I often think about all the different kinds of tea there are in the world, their benefits, their tastes, their smells. I thought I was doomed to just stay stuck with knock-off store brand tea bags to satisfy my herbal fixation when I heard of something amazing.


cue choir of angels......NOW!
Teavana is a store literally dedicated to tea. They sell seven different types of tea, each with different flavors and blends. There's one out there for you folks. I assure you.
The tea specialists are friendly and very knowledgable about what they're selling. They offer free samples and demonstrations of their products and if you frequent at their they actually remember who you are (right Joe?).
The place literally looks like you walked into an asian tea shop. It's decorated with different tea pots and tea cups that just make you jealous of the bastards that get to stare at them all day. Seriously, those tea pots remind me that I'm poor by just looking at them. No store has made me feel so depressed and so zhen at the same time.
The tea is definately worth a try though. And those bastards are so good at selling it that you leave the store short fifty-six bucks, with a pound of skinny chai pu-ehr tea in your hands without even realizing what just happened. Speaking which of, I think I'll have a cup.
